Online Tests for ADHD: Understanding Hyperactivity and Attention Deficit Disorders<br>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that impacts millions of people worldwide. Defined by relentless patterns of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ity, ADHD can substantially impact numerous elements of a person's life, consisting of scholastic efficiency, occupational success, and interpersonal relationships. Offered the complexities of identifying ADHD, online tests have emerged as a popular tool for initial assessment. This article explores the energy of online tests for ADHD, their pros and cons, and how they fit into the bigger diagnostic process.<br>Comprehending ADHD<br>ADHD is typically identified in childhood, though it can continue into adolescence and the [Adult ADHD Test](https://faq.sectionsanywhere.com/user/textrod2) years. Symptoms can manifest variably, resulting in different presentations such as primarily neglectful type, primarily hyperactive-impulsive type, and combined type.
